fuse4fs: don't use inode number translation when possible
Prior to the integration of iomap into fuse, the fuse client (aka the
kernel) required that the root directory have an inumber of
FUSE_ROOT_ID, which is 1. However, the ext2 filesystem defines the root
inode number to be EXT2_ROOT_INO, which is 2. This dissonance means
that we have to have translator functions, and that any access to
inumber 1 (the ext2 badblocks file) will instead redirect to the root
directory.
That's horrible. Use the new mount option to set the root directory
nodeid to EXT2_ROOT_INO so that we don't need this translation.
